Piquet slammed for 'unacceptable racist' Hamilton comments

Formula 1 branded a racist term used by three-time World Champion Nelson Piquet against Lewis Hamilton as 'unacceptable' on Tuesday. The 69-year-old Brazilian, who won the world title in 1981, 1983 and 1987, used a racially offensive term when referring to Hamilton on a Brazilian podcast. 'Discriminatory or racist language is unacceptable in any form and has no part in society,' Formula 1 said in a statement. Lewis is an incredible ambassador for our sport and deserves respect.
